A comprehensive new study found low-wage workers are routinely denied proper overtime pay and are often paid less than the minimum wage. The study surveyed 4,387 workers (39% illegal immigrants, 31% legal immigrants, and 30% native-born Americans) in various low-wage industries, including apparel manufacturing, child care and discount retailing.

According to a study published in the journal BMC Public Health, children as young as 10- and 11-years-old already have notions about the ideal body.
